@charset "utf-8";
/* CSS Document */

body	{
background-image: url(../_gfx/bgrnd.gif);
background-repeat: repeat-x;
background-position: top;
background-color: #b7b7b7;
margin: 0px;
padding: 0px;
font-family: Tahoma;
font-size: 12px;
color: #000000;
}

#siteHolder	{
width: 100%;
margin-top: 25px;
}

a	{
font-family: Tahoma;
font-size: 12px;
color: #000000;
text-decoration: none;
position: relative;
}

a:hover	{
font-family: Tahoma;
font-size: 12px;
color: #000000;
text-decoration: underline;
}

#mainAreaSize	{
background-image: url(../_gfx/bgrndMain.png);
background-repeat: no-repeat;
height: 536px;
width: 960px;
text-align: left;
}

DIV.mainAreaHolder	{
height:350px;
width: 940px;
}

DIV.mainHeader	{
padding-right: 20px;
width: 940px;
}

DIV.mainHeaderLeft	{
float: left;
padding-left: 30px;
padding-top: 28px;
}

DIV.mainHeaderRight	{
float: right;
}

DIV.clear	{
clear: both;
}

DIV.playersName	{
background-image:url(../_gfx/playersName.png);
width: 412px;
height: 44px;
background-repeat: no-repeat;
}

DIV.playersNumber	{
background-image:url(../_gfx/number.png);
width: 120px;
height: 151px;
background-repeat: no-repeat;
}

DIV.topMenuBg	{
background-image: url(../_gfx/bgrndTopMenu.png);
background-repeat: no-repeat;
width: 770px;
height: 30px;
margin-top: 9px;
}

DIV.menuTxt	{
float: left;
text-align:center;
}

DIV.menuTxtOn	{
float: left;
background-image: url(../_gfx/bgrndMenuTxt.png);
background-repeat: repeat-x;
text-align:center;
padding: 6px 0px 8px 0px;
color: #ffffff;
font-size: 13px;
font-weight: bold;
}

DIV.menuHomeOn	{
background-image: url(../_gfx/bgrndMenuHomeOn.png);
background-repeat: no-repeat;
float: left;
text-align:center;
padding: 6px 11px 8px 11px;
color: #ffffff;
font-size: 13px;
font-weight: bold;
}

DIV.menuContactOn	{
background-image: url(../_gfx/bgrndMenuContactOn.png);
background-repeat: no-repeat;
float: left;
text-align:center;
padding: 6px 0px 8px 0px;
color: #ffffff;
font-size: 13px;
font-weight: bold;
}

a.menuHome	{
padding: 6px 11px 8px 11px;
color: #ffffff;
font-size: 13px;
font-weight: bold;
text-decoration: none;
display: block;
height: 30px;
}

a.menuHome:hover	{
background-image: url(../_gfx/bgrndMenuHomeOn.png);
background-repeat: no-repeat;
text-decoration: none;
display: block;
height: 30px;
color: #ffffff;
font-size: 13px;
}

a.menuContact	{
padding: 6px 11px 8px 11px;
color: #ffffff;
font-size: 13px;
font-weight: bold;
text-decoration: none;
display: block;
height: 30px;
}

a.menuContact:hover	{
background-image: url(../_gfx/bgrndMenuContactOn.png);
background-repeat: no-repeat;
text-decoration: none;
display: block;
height: 30px;
color: #ffffff;
font-size: 13px;
}

a.menuTxt	{
padding: 6px 11px 8px 11px;
color: #ffffff;
font-size: 13px;
font-weight: bold;
text-decoration: none;
display: block;
height: 30px;
}

a.menuTxt:hover	{
background-image: url(../_gfx/bgrndMenuTxt.png);
background-repeat: repeat-x;
text-decoration: none;
color: #ffffff;
font-size: 13px;
}

DIV.menuLineFade	{
float: left;
width: 1px;
height: 30px;
background-color: #FFFFFF;
filter:alpha(opacity=60);/* for IE */
opacity:0.6;/* CSS3 standard */
}

DIV.CategoryTitle	{
color: #b40800;
font-size: 18px;
width: 770px;
padding-left: 11px;
margin-top: 14px;
}

DIV.CategoryTitleLeft	{
float: left;

}

DIV.CategoryTitleRight	{
float: right;
width: 100px;
}

DIV.homeCvArea	{
float: left;
background-image: url(../_gfx/boxWhiteLarge.png);
background-repeat: no-repeat;
width: 648px;
height: 317px;
}

DIV.homeNewsArea	{
float: right;
height: 317px;
width: 240px;
padding-left: 20px;
text-align: left;
}

DIV.homeNewsHolder	{
height: 228px;
}

DIV.homeNewsBox	{
background-image: url(../_gfx/boxNewsSmall.png);
background-repeat: no-repeat;
height: 66px;
width: 228px;
text-align: left;
padding-bottom: 10px;
}


DIV.logoVolleyA1	{
float: left;
width: 123px;
height: 86px;
}

DIV.logoVolleyA1Right	{
float: right;
color: #878787;
font-size: 11px;
width: 110px;
padding-top: 24px;
}

DIV.homeCvLeft	{
float: left;
padding-top: 11px;
}

DIV.homeCvRight	{
float: right;
padding-top: 11px;
width: 360px;
}

DIV.homePhoto	{
background-image: url(../_gfx/photoRouxi01.jpg);
background-repeat: no-repeat;
background-position: center;
}

DIV.homeGalleryButton	{
background-image: url(../_gfx/galleryButton.png);
background-repeat: no-repeat;
width: 265px;
height: 23px;
margin-left: 10px;
margin-top: 12px;
}

a.GalleryButtonTxt	{
font-size:12px;
font-weight: bold;
color: #ffffff;
text-align: right;
padding-top: 4px;
padding-right: 45px;
display: block;
text-decoration: none;
}

a.GalleryButtonTxt:hover	{
text-decoration: underline;
color: #ffffff;
}

DIV.homeCvTitle	{
float: left;
font-size: 12px;
font-weight: bold;
color: #b40800;
padding-top: 8px;
line-height:160%;
}

DIV.homeCvTitleBox	{
float: right;
background-image: url(../_gfx/boxCvBgSmall.png);
background-repeat: no-repeat;
width: 210px;
height: 132px;
padding: 8px 0px 0px 11px;
line-height:160%;
}

font.TxtBold	{
font-size: 12px;
font-weight: bold;
color: #b40800;
}

DIV.CvTxtMore	{
padding-top: 40px;
padding-right: 20px;
}

DIV.homeNewsTxt	{
background-image: url(../_gfx/boxGreen.gif);
background-repeat: no-repeat;
background-position: 10px 10px;
padding: 8px 20px 0px 30px;
}

a.TxtBold	{
font-size: 12px;
font-weight: bold;
color: #b40800;
text-decoration: none;
}

a.TxtBold:hover	{
font-size: 12px;
font-weight: bold;
color: #b40800;
text-decoration: underline;
}

DIV.footer	{
font-family: Arial;
font-size: 10px;
color: #FFFFFF;
padding-left: 50px;
text-transform: uppercase;
}

a.footer	{
font-family: Arial;
font-size: 10px;
color: #FFFFFF;
text-decoration: none;
}

a.footer:hover	{
font-family: Arial;
font-size: 10px;
color: #FFFFFF;
text-decoration: underline;
}

/*cv area */

DIV.CvArea	{
float: left;
background-image: url(../_gfx/boxWhiteLarge2.png);
background-repeat: no-repeat;
width: 769px;
height: 317px;
}

DIV.scroller	{
margin-top: 9px;
overflow : auto;
width: 752px;
height: 300px;
scrollbar-face-color: #eeeeee; 
scrollbar-highlight-color: #d0d0d0; 
scrollbar-3dlight-color: #d0d0d0; 
scrollbar-darkshadow-color: #d0d0d0; 
scrollbar-shadow-color: #d0d0d0; 
scrollbar-arrow-color: #8b8b8b; 
scrollbar-track-color: #d0d0d0;
position: relative;
}

DIV.CvAreaRight	{
float: right;
width: 120px;
padding-top: 150px;
}

DIV.CvLeft	{
float: left;
margin-top: 2px;
}

DIV.CvRight	{
float: right;
margin-top: 2px;
width: 560px;
}

DIV.CvTitleBox	{
float: right;
background-image: url(../_gfx/boxCvBgLarge.png);
background-repeat: no-repeat;
width: 380px;
height: 158px;
padding: 8px 0px 0px 11px;
line-height:190%;
}

DIV.CvTitle	{
float: left;
font-size: 12px;
font-weight: bold;
color: #b40800;
padding-top: 8px;
margin-left: 20px;
line-height:190%;
}

DIV.logoVolleyA1inner	{
color: #878787;
font-size: 11px;
padding-top: 7px;
}

/*news area */

DIV.NewsArea	{
float: left;
background-image: url(../_gfx/boxWhiteLarge2.png);
background-repeat: no-repeat;
width: 769px;
height: 317px;
}

DIV.Newsscroller	{
margin-top: 14px;
margin-left: 10px;
overflow : auto;
width: 748px;
height: 235px;
scrollbar-face-color: #eeeeee; 
scrollbar-highlight-color: #d0d0d0; 
scrollbar-3dlight-color: #d0d0d0; 
scrollbar-darkshadow-color: #d0d0d0; 
scrollbar-shadow-color: #d0d0d0; 
scrollbar-arrow-color: #8b8b8b; 
scrollbar-track-color: #d0d0d0;
position: relative;
}

DIV.NewsAreaRight	{
float: right;
width: 120px;
padding-top: 150px;
}

DIV.NewsLeft	{
margin-top: 2px;
padding: 0px 10px 0px 0px;
}

DIV.NewsTitleBox	{
margin: 10px 0px 0px 10px;
background-image: url(../_gfx/boxNewsTitleIn.png);
background-repeat: no-repeat;
width: 747px;
height: 26px;
padding: 6px 0px 0px 0px;
}

DIV.NewsTitle	{
font-size: 12px;
font-weight: bold;
color: #b40800;
margin-left: 4px;
}

DIV.NewsListscroller	{
margin-top: 10px;
margin-left: 10px;
overflow : auto;
width: 746px;
height: 296px;
scrollbar-face-color: #eeeeee; 
scrollbar-highlight-color: #d0d0d0; 
scrollbar-3dlight-color: #d0d0d0; 
scrollbar-darkshadow-color: #d0d0d0; 
scrollbar-shadow-color: #d0d0d0; 
scrollbar-arrow-color: #8b8b8b; 
scrollbar-track-color: #d0d0d0;
position: relative;
}

DIV.NewsListBox01	{
background-image: url(../_gfx/bgrndNewsList01.png);
background-repeat: no-repeat;
width: 700px;
height: 27px;
margin: 10px;
}

DIV.NewsListBox02	{
background-image: url(../_gfx/bgrndNewsList02.png);
background-repeat: no-repeat;
width: 700px;
height: 27px;
margin: 10px;
}

DIV.NewsListTxt	{
font-size: 13px;
color: #000000;
font-weight: normal;
text-align: left;
width: 700px;
padding: 5px 0px 0px 10px;
}

DIV.NewsListLeft	{
margin-top: 2px;
width: 700px;
}

/*Links css*/

DIV.LinksLeft	{
margin-top: 2px;
padding: 0px 0px 0px 0px;
width: 720px;
}

DIV.LinksLeftBox	{
float: left;
padding-left: 10px;
width: 345px;
}

DIV.Linksscroller	{
float: left;
background-image: url(../_gfx/vertLineLinks.png);
background-repeat: no-repeat;
background-position: 348px;
margin-top: 14px;
margin-left: 10px;
overflow : auto;
width: 746px;
height: 250px;
scrollbar-face-color: #eeeeee; 
scrollbar-highlight-color: #d0d0d0; 
scrollbar-3dlight-color: #d0d0d0; 
scrollbar-darkshadow-color: #d0d0d0; 
scrollbar-shadow-color: #d0d0d0; 
scrollbar-arrow-color: #8b8b8b; 
scrollbar-track-color: #d0d0d0;
position: relative;
}

DIV.LinksRightBox	{
float: right;
padding-left: 14px;
width: 345px;
}

DIV.LinksLogoLeft	{
float: left;
height: 57px;
width: 83px;
vertical-align: middle;
}

DIV.LinksRow	{
margin: 0px 0px 5px 0px;
}

DIV.LinksRowGrey	{
margin: 0px 0px 5px 0px;
}

DIV.LinksLogoRight	{
background-image: url(../_gfx/boxLinks01.png);
background-repeat:no-repeat;
float: right;
height: 57px;
width: 251px;
padding: 5px;
}

DIV.LinksLogoRightGrey	{
background-image: url(../_gfx/boxLinks02.png);
background-repeat:no-repeat;
float: right;
height: 57px;
width: 251px;
padding: 5px;
}

/*statistics css */

DIV.Statisticsscroller	{
float: left;
margin-top: 14px;
overflow : auto;
width: 746px;
height: 260px;
scrollbar-face-color: #eeeeee; 
scrollbar-highlight-color: #d0d0d0; 
scrollbar-3dlight-color: #d0d0d0; 
scrollbar-darkshadow-color: #d0d0d0; 
scrollbar-shadow-color: #d0d0d0; 
scrollbar-arrow-color: #8b8b8b; 
scrollbar-track-color: #d0d0d0;
position: relative;
}

DIV.StatisticsLeftBox	{
float: left;
width: 285px;
}

DIV.StatisticsRightBox	{
float: right;
}

DIV.StatisticsLeft	{
margin-top: 2px;
width: 720px;
}

DIV.statisticsBox01	{
background-image: url(../_gfx/statisticsBox01.png);
background-repeat: no-repeat;
width: 413px;
height: 27px;
margin: 10px;
}

DIV.statisticsBox02	{
background-image: url(../_gfx/statisticsBox02.png);
background-repeat: no-repeat;
width: 413px;
height: 27px;
margin: 10px;
}

DIV.statisticsTxtTitle	{
float: left;
padding: 5px 0px 0px 40px;
font-size: 13px;
color: #b40800;
font-weight: bold;
width: 55px;
}

DIV.statisticsTxt	{
float: right;
font-size: 13px;
color: #000000;
font-weight: normal;
text-align: left;
width: 290px;
padding: 5px 0px 0px 20px;
}

/*contact css */


DIV.formTextFieldBox	{
float: right;
background-image: url(../_gfx/formTextField.png);
background-repeat: no-repeat;
font-size: 13px;
color: #000000;
font-weight: normal;
width: 223px;
height: 144px;
padding-right: 6px;
}


DIV.Contactscroller	{
float: left;
margin-top: 34px;
overflow : auto;
width: 746px;
height: 280px;
scrollbar-face-color: #eeeeee; 
scrollbar-highlight-color: #d0d0d0; 
scrollbar-3dlight-color: #d0d0d0; 
scrollbar-darkshadow-color: #d0d0d0; 
scrollbar-shadow-color: #d0d0d0; 
scrollbar-arrow-color: #8b8b8b; 
scrollbar-track-color: #d0d0d0;
position: relative;
}

DIV.ContactLeftBox	{
float: left;
width: 350px;
}

DIV.ContactRightBox	{
float: right;
width: 350px;
}

DIV.fieldBox	{
padding: 6px;
}

DIV.formTxtBox	{
float: left;
font-size: 13px;
text-align: right;
color: #b40800;
font-weight: bold;
padding: 4px 0px 0px 0px;
width: 90px;
}

DIV.formFieldBox	{
float: right;
font-size: 13px;
color: #000000;
font-weight: normal;
}

input.FieldRequired	{
background-image: url(../_gfx/formFieldRequired.png);
background-repeat: no-repeat;
width: 223px;
height: 25px;
border: 0px;
padding-left: 5px;
padding-top: 4px;
position: relative;
}

input.Field	{
background-image: url(../_gfx/formField.png);
background-repeat: no-repeat;
width: 223px;
height: 25px;
border: 0px;
padding-left: 5px;
padding-top: 4px;
position: relative;
}

textarea.FieldBox	{
width: 210px;
height: 128px;
background-image: url(../_gfx/bgrndTextField.gif);
background-repeat:repeat-x;
background-position: bottom;
border: 0px;
margin: 4px;
padding-left: 0px;
padding-top: 4px;
padding-bottom: 0px;
overflow: hidden;
position: relative;
}

DIV.formButtonHolder	{
margin-left: 116px;
margin-right: 10px;
}

DIV.formButtonCancel	{
float: left;
background-image: url(../_gfx/formButtonCancel.png);
background-repeat: no-repeat;
width: 105px;
height: 23px;
}

a.formCancelTxt	{
font-size: 12px;
color: #FFFFFF;
font-weight: bold;
text-decoration: none;
display: block;
padding: 3px 0px 0px 30px;
}

a.formCancelTxt:hover	{
font-size: 12px;
color: #FFFFFF;
font-weight: bold;
text-decoration: none;
display: block;
}

a.formSendTxt	{
font-size: 12px;
color: #FFFFFF;
font-weight: bold;
text-decoration: none;
display: block;
padding: 3px 0px 0px 10px;
}

a.formSendTxt:hover	{
font-size: 12px;
color: #FFFFFF;
font-weight: bold;
text-decoration: none;
display: block;
}

DIV.formButtonSend	{
float: right;
background-image: url(../_gfx/formButtonSend.png);
background-repeat: no-repeat;
width: 105px;
height: 23px;
}

DIV.requiredTxt	{
background-image:url(../_gfx/required.gif);
background-repeat: no-repeat;
height: 19px;
margin-left: 16px;
margin-top: 10px;
padding-top: 8px;
padding-left: 24px;
font-size: 10px;
}
/* photo gallery css */

DIV.Pgalleryscroller	{
margin-top: 15px;
margin-left: 6px;
overflow : auto;
width: 220px;
height: 250px;
scrollbar-face-color: #eeeeee; 
scrollbar-highlight-color: #d0d0d0; 
scrollbar-3dlight-color: #d0d0d0; 
scrollbar-darkshadow-color: #d0d0d0; 
scrollbar-shadow-color: #d0d0d0; 
scrollbar-arrow-color: #8b8b8b; 
scrollbar-track-color: #d0d0d0;
position: relative;
}

DIV.PgalleryLeftBox	{
float: left;
width: 770px;
margin-top: 6px;
}

DIV.PgalleryBox	{
float: right;
background-image: url(../_gfx/bgrndPgalleryThumb.png);
background-repeat: no-repeat;
width: 231px;
height: 286px;
padding-right: 9px;
margin-top: 10px;
}

DIV.PgalleryLeft	{
margin-top: 2px;
}
